Primary Purpose
Responsible for sourcing and recruiting talent for all talent programs across the organization, as well as developing marketing material for these programs. Focus will be on sourcing by networking with potential candidates through multiple platforms (i.e., career fairs, classroom presentations, conferences, social platforms including LinkedIn, etc.). Additionally, they should have the ability to identify top talent and attract those candidates to the organization.
Major Duties & Responsibilities
Plan, schedule and attend recruitment events including career fairs, classroom presentations, on-site tours and more. Identify and target high-potential candidates both in person, at events and by screening resumes, conducting initial interviews and coordinating further interviews with management. Build and maintain strong relationships with students, professors, advisors and other stakeholders we partner with at key schools.
Develop and maintain a brand for Early Talent Programs and Talent Acquisition by developing marketing material for all talent programs. This includes branding processes from recruitment displays, interview processes, onboarding processes for Early Talent Programs, MST and more. Staying up-to-date with new trends and advancements in the employment market and field of education is imperative to the success of this branding process. Responsible for maintaining and updating social platforms with content on a regular cadence such as LinkedIn and Instagram.
Document recruitment processes and track recruitment data. This includes maintaining the database of information (i.e., Monday.com or Salesforce) with necessary upgrades and changes needed for best realtime data capture.
Responsible for building and maintaining the Veteran's Program for the organization and sourcing veterans through this effort as well.
Support the Early Talent Programs Specialists with the onboarding program and overall scheduling of Interns and Management Trainees. Aid in integrating new hires into Mountaire's culture and Way of Being.
